range of contribution
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"range of contribution"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e the variety or extent of input or support provided by individuals or groups in a particular context. Example: "The project was successful due to the diverse range of contribution from team members, each bringing unique skills and perspectives."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When describing the different types of contributions, use specific examples to illustrate the "range of contribution". For instance, instead of saying "a wide range of contribution", specify "a range of contribution including financial support, technical expertise, and marketing assistance".
Common error
Avoid using vague language when referring to "range of contribution". Instead of saying something like "the project benefited from a wide range of contribution", specify the areas or types of support received. This provides clarity and demonstrates the value of the contributions.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"range of contribution" functions as a noun phrase, typically serving as the object of a verb or preposition. It describes the scope or variety of input, support, or influence provided, as seen in the Ludwig examples.

Ludwig's WRAP-UP
In summary, "range of contribution" is a grammatically sound noun phrase used to describe the scope or variety of input. Ludwig AI confirms its usability. While its frequency is rare, it appears primarily in scientific, news, and academic contexts. When using this phrase, it's beneficial to provide specific examples to enhance clarity. Alternatives like "scope of contribution" or "variety of contributions" can also be considered. The phrase has a neutral to formal register, making it suitable for diverse writing scenarios.

FAQs
How can I illustrate the "range of contribution" in a project?
Provide specific examples of the different types of contributions made. For example, "The project benefited from a range of contributions, including financial backing, volunteer hours, and in-kind donations." This approach clarifies the value and scope of the support.
What's a more formal way to describe "range of contribution"?
Consider using terms like "scope of contribution" or "extent of input" as more formal alternatives. These phrases maintain a professional tone while conveying the same meaning.
Is it correct to say "wide range of contribution"?
Yes, it's grammatically correct, but ensure you follow it with specific examples of the kinds of inputs or support received to provide context.
What are some alternatives to "range of contribution" that emphasize the diversity of inputs?
You can use alternatives such as "variety of contributions" or "spectrum of influence", depending on the specific nuances you want to convey.
